Description and references
Prepn: Clark, US 2712012 (1955 to Am. Cyanamid). Toxicity: Seki et al., Arzneim.-Forsch. 15, 1441 (1965). Toxicological, chemotherapeutic and
pharmacokinetic studies: Bhni et al., Chemotherapy 14, 195-226 (1969).
Properties
Bitter crystals from water, mp 182-183°. pKa 6.7. Soly in water at 37° (mg/100 ml):
110 at pH 5; 120 at pH 6; 147 at pH 6.5. Slightly sol in methanol,
ethanol (about 1:200); more sol in acetone (1:50), in dimethylformamide
(1 g/1 ml). Freely sol in aq solns of alkali hydroxides. LD50 orally in mice:
1750 mg/kg,
(Seki).Derivative
